This song is not about Russia and Ukraine being sisters. This is a Czech song about Czech's slavic sister Ukraine being attacked by the same nation that invaded Czechoslovakia in 1968 during Prague Spring. Czechs feel very strong solidarity with Ukraine because the Warsaw Pact invasion of 68 (which Ukraine participated in mind you, with Russia) was the reason Czechs have silently but strongly despised Russians for far longer before Ukraine's current situation. The song lyrics clearly talk about slavic countries coming from the same cultural and linguistic family (hence sisters) being under attack by someone that is supposed to be close to them yet betrays them, choosing power over love (hence them saying choose love over power, that is aimed at the invader that is choosing power over love for its neighbours). The opening lyrics in Czech are clearly aimed as a defence of Ukraine "my sister won't be cornered, she won't listen to you, my sister is wild at heart, she won't have her hair braided (by russia), she won't listen to you." And thus Czech's sister Ukraine shall keep her crown (pride and independence) and not have it taken down by Russia.
